I followed the instructions and sanitized them by boiling them in water for 3 minutes. I folded the cup like the directions showed and placed it. I did have to trim the stem as suggested if needed and it does also make it a little harder in regards to twisting it to create the seal that is required. It does take some time to get it placed properly. It also is a little hard to turn to make sure it creates the seal that is required to prevent leakage, so I would suggest using a liner until you get the process down and know it is in place and sealed. If properly sanitized and used, they say it can last years according to the company.




It suggests buying the size 2 if you have had children, however, I did go with the size one and I have had two children and did have to trim the stem on it. There are other factors to consider when choosing the right size and if unsure I would suggest checking with your doctor. Overall it is a great concept to help reduce the risk of toxic shock syndrome if you primarily use tampons and I just think takes time to get the process figured out for getting it in place.
